What is the difference between Internship Energy Engineer vs Energy Analyst?

AspectInternship Energy EngineerEnergy Analyst
Required CredentialsEnrolled in or recent graduate of engineering or related programBachelor's degree in engineering, environmental science, or related field
Work EnvironmentInternship setting, often in engineering teams or project sitesOffice-based, data analysis, report writing
Employer & Industry UsageUtilities, renewable energy companies, engineering firmsEnergy consulting firms, corporate energy departments

Internship Energy Engineers typically focus on gaining practical engineering experience during their studies, working on technical projects. Energy Analysts analyze data, develop reports, and provide insights on energy consumption and efficiency. While both roles involve energy concepts, internships are more hands-on engineering experiences, whereas analysts focus on data and strategic analysis.

Quanta Power Solutions is seeking a motivated Electrical Engineer I to join our growing EPC team supporting projects across the power sector, including power generation, renewable energy, battery energy storage systems (BESS), substations, and transmission systems. This role offers an exciting opportunity for early-career engineers to gain hands-on experience supporting the design, development, and execution of complex energy infrastructure projects. 

Working alongside experienced engineers and project teams, the Electrical Engineer I will assist with electrical system design, calculations, drawing development, field support, and multidisciplinary coordination while building a strong foundation in EPC project execution. 


  • Assist with the design and development of electrical systems for power and industrial projects  
  • Support preparation of electrical deliverables including single-line diagrams, schematics, panel layouts, cable schedules, grounding plans, and equipment layouts  
  • Perform basic electrical calculations including voltage drop, conduit fill, cable sizing, lighting, and load analysis  
  • Assist with development of construction packages, specifications, and technical documentation  
  • Coordinate with engineering disciplines to support integrated project designs  
  • Review vendor drawings and equipment submittals for compliance with project requirements  
  • Support field activities including site visits, construction support, startup, and commissioning efforts  
  • Assist with material take-offs, project estimates, and procurement support activities  
  • Participate in design reviews and quality assurance processes  
  • Maintain compliance with company standards, client specifications, and applicable industry codes and regulations  
  • Employee may be required to visit job sites, field offices, and customer locations

Required Qualifications 

  •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ering from an ABET-accredited university  
  • 0–3 years of electrical engineering experience  
  • Basic understanding of electrical engineering principles and power systems  
  • Familiarity with AutoCAD, Revit, or similar design software  
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ite  
  • Strong analytical, organizational, and problem-solving skills  
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ills  
  • Ability to work effectively in both team and independent environments  

Preferred Qualifications 

  • Internship or co-op experience supporting EPC, utility, industrial, or construction projects  
  • Exposure to power generation, substations, transmission systems, renewable energy, or BESS projects  
  • Familiarity with the National Electrical Code (NEC) and applicable industry standards  
  • Engineer-in-Training (EIT) certification or progress toward licensure  
  • Experience with SKM, ETAP, or other power system analysis software
